Dateline: Circa 1820 |
Item# 31892 |
|
|
|
A very fine New Hall porcelain coffee can decorated with the Beehive pattern 752 in the rich Imari palette of cobalt and iron red, with lavish gilding. The can has the characteristic New Hall ring handle, slightly flattened in section. A lovely piece. More Info »
2.3" high.

*Sligh Sale Prices are published as a guide only. The value of antiques, art and vintage collectibles can fluctuate, and vary between trade, auction & open-market values, retail prices and insurance valuations. For insurance purposes, insuring a high-value item or collection, we recommend a first-hand appraisal and renewed valuation every 5-7 years.
